1. In accordance with section 733(d) of the Tariff Act of 1930, as amended (19 U.S.C. Section 1673b(d)), Commerce is instructing CBP to discontinue the suspension of liquidation of entries concerning the antidumping duty investigation of brass rod from Israel effective 06/11/2024, which is the day after provisional measures in this proceeding has been in place for 180 days. 2. The products covered by this investigation are described in message 3348405 dated 12/14/2023. 3. This proceeding has been assigned case number A-508-814. 4. CBP shall discontinue the suspension of liquidation for antidumping duty purposes on all shipments of subject merchandise entered, or withdrawn from warehouse, for consumption on or after 06/11/2024 (the first day provisional measures are no longer in effect). The suspension of liquidation will not be resumed unless and until a final affirmative determination on this case is published in the Federal Register by the ITC. 5. These discontinuation instructions do not apply to subject merchandise subject to suspension of liquidation and imposition of cash deposits, entered, or withdrawn from warehouse, for consumption on or before 06/10/2024 (the date provisional measures expired in this proceeding). 6.
